Eco-Friendly Reading Glasses

by Brian Yalung on Monday, August 3rd, 2009

summers1

FGX International Inc. announces the release of the new Green View Collection, new eco-friendly reading glasses that one can buy over the counter of leading retail stores. They are made of 100% recycled materials, prescription-quality lenses and a renewable fiber case.

The Green View collection includes men’s, women’s, and unisex styles with plastic frames made from 100 percent recycled materials. Lenses are hard-coated, thin, scratch-resistant and designed to reduce distortion. Spring hinges on most styles ensure a close and comfortable fit. The collection may be found at large retailers, including Walmart, Walgreens, Barnes & Noble and CVS stores nationwide, with prices starting at $16.
